Potential Fines and Outcomes



Dealing with a DWI fee can bring about a series of charges that vary depending upon a number of factors, including your blood alcohol focus (BAC) level, prior offenses, and whether there were aggravating situations, like a mishap or injury.

If it's your initial offense, you could encounter penalties, license suspension, and potentially required alcohol education and learning courses. Nevertheless, if your BAC was especially high or if you have actually had previous convictions, charges can escalate dramatically.

For a second or third violation, you could be considering raised fines, longer certificate suspensions, and also prison time. In some cases, installation of an ignition interlock device may be needed to reclaim driving privileges.

If you caused a mishap or injury while driving under the influence, the repercussions can be much more serious, consisting of felony costs and substantial jail time.
